#9f8bde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9f8bde is composed of 62.4% red, 54.5%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.4% cyan, 37.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 254.5 degrees, a saturation of 55.7% and a lightness of 70.8%. #9f8bde color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#3f17bd.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#9f8bde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9f8bde has RGB values of R:159, G:139,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 10456030.

Hex triplet 9f8bde #9f8bde
RGB Decimal 159, 139, 222 rgb(159,139,222)
RGB Percent 62.4, 54.5, 87.1 rgb(62.4%,54.5%,87.1%)
CMYK 28, 37, 0, 13
HSL 254.5°, 55.7, 70.8 hsl(254.5,55.7%,70.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 254.5°, 37.4, 87.1
Web Safe 9999cc #9999cc
CIE-LAB 62.6, 25.342, -39.667
XYZ 36.713, 31.11, 73.174
xyY 0.26, 0.221, 31.11
CIE-LCH 62.6, 47.071, 302.574
CIE-LUV 62.6, 4.32, -65.929
Hunter-Lab 55.776, 19.884, -38.74
Binary 10011111, 10001011, 11011110

Shades and Tints of #9f8bde

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030206 is the darkest color, while #f7f6fc is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#9f8bde is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#9a9a9a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#9b97a8 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#7f9ae6 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#819bdb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#969da8 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#8a94e3 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#8c95dc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#9996bb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
